Artists Announced: BEYOND Autumn Award 2024
BEYOND AUTUMN AWARD 2024. The Work Room is pleased to announce the next member-led project awarded seed funding from BEYOND in the 2024 funding cycle.
In September, we held the third awards draw of BEYOND in the 2024 funding cycle, to select a recipient of the BEYOND Autumn Award 2024.
Beyond is a seed funding initiative, which aims to nurture, support and kick start artist-led projects and practices that take dance beyond the studio to connect more people to dance, while also fostering collaboration and artistic community within TWR membership.
Piloting a first round in 2018, Beyond was relaunched in May 2022 following a period of consultation with a working group of members, to redesign the fund and experiment with different processes of decision-making, adopting a random selection process for awarding funds. BEYOND is now in its third funding cycle. In the 2024 Awards ccyle, BEYOND is making 4 x seed funding awards of £1500.
The Beyond Autumn Award 2024 was made following a peer review process by members Jen Wren and Natalia Barua, who checked the EOIs against the fund’s eligibility criteria, shared some responses and thoughts on the proposals to support their onward journey, and witnessed the random selection process to confirm its legitimacy.
We are happy to announce the project selected in this round is ‘The Canary Jam: A digital movement space for delicate bodies’ by Stephanie Arsoska & Laura Steckler.
The Canary Jam will explore the co-creation of an online movement improvisation space for people who experience PEM (post exertional malaise) or energy limitations.
The project will see Laura & Stephanie research and exchange ideas for structure and approach to practice, before taking their experiments into a digital space with participants. Aiming to be a nourishing and compassionate space encouraging rest and minimalism, they will collaborate closely with participants, sharing and incorporating ideas and feedback to experiment with accessible approaches to moving with fatigue.
Through the project they hope to begin utilising digital platforms to co-create a remote community of people with energy limitations who would like to explore ways to safely move, dance together and inspire one another.
